Debra Mustain Obituary

Debra Faye Mustain, age 66 of Jeffersonville, passed away Wednesday, April 8, 2026, leaving behind a legacy of love, faith, and selfless devotion to others.

For more than twenty years, Debra served faithfully as a paralegal, bringing diligence and care to her work. Yet her true calling extended far beyond any profession. During her time at Freed-Hardeman University, she first served as a Dorm Mother and later as Housing Director, where she became a steady, comforting presence to countless students. Debra had a special place in her heart for those who were far from home, especially during the holidays. She lovingly prepared meals and opened her heart to them, creating a sense of family where it was needed most. To many, she was more than a mentor—she was a second mother.

A devoted member of Northside Church of Christ in Jeffersonville, Debra lived out her faith in both word and action. She taught Sunday School, led adult classes and spoke at organized retreats, always striving to uplift and encourage others in their walk with Christ. Her servant’s heart led her to volunteer as a camp counselor at Spring Mill Bible Camp, where she joyfully shared her faith and helped shape the lives of young people.

Debra was the heart of her home. She found great joy in cooking for her family, filling her kitchen with warmth, laughter, and song. She took pride in preparing her boys’ favorite meals—most famously her fried chicken, made with love and always requested. Her home was a place of comfort, where everyone felt welcomed, cared for, and deeply loved.

She was preceded in death by her grandparents, Frank and Mary Harris, and her lifelong best friend, Sherry Morris.

Debra leaves behind a loving family who will cherish her memory always: her devoted husband of 48 years, John Mustain; her sons, Joey (Karen) Mustain and Shane (Candice) Mustain; her parents, Harold and Bonnie Faye (Harris) Maultsby; her sisters, Pam (David) Lynch and Rhonda (Larry) Thomas; her treasured grandchildren, John Michael, Stella, & Braydon; and her dear friend, Danny Morris.

Debra’s life was a beautiful reflection of kindness, generosity, and unwavering faith. She gave freely of herself, always putting others first and making the world a little brighter with every life she touched. Her love will continue to live on in the hearts of all who knew her.
